Ticket #2209 — FX rounding drift blocked by connection failures

The Coinpress conversion service is accumulating rounding errors on multi-hop currency conversions, and the reconciliation job that would correct them keeps failing to connect to the ledger store. Retries exhaust after five attempts. On-call: restart the reconciler, confirm the rounding mode is banker's, and verify drift totals manually. To query the ledger directly, use the connection string below.

replica DSN, fadup-yagug: mssql://rusox_svc:0K2wrVJefbkR2n@db-53b3.qirvangrid.example:5432/istix

# Break-Glass: Catalog Cache Invalidation

Scope: the Pinrow product catalog at Veldstone Retail. If stale prices persist after a purge and the Hollowmere invalidation queue is wedged, use break-glass to flush the edge tier directly. Contractors: get verbal sign-off from the catalog lead first. Steps: open the Hollowmere admin shell, select emergency-flush, confirm the tenant, and run it once — repeated flushes thrash the origin. Access is logged and expires after 20 minutes. Unseal the admin shell with the passphrase below.

recovery phrase for kahop-tajog: istix-casvan

The Scanlark barcode integration accepts scans over a single REST endpoint, `/v1/scans`. Each payload includes the symbology, raw value, and the station identifier of the handheld unit. Decoding happens device-side; the API only validates checksums and routes the event to the inventory ledger. Malformed scans return a 422 with a reason code you can surface to the operator. All requests to the scan endpoint must include this bearer token:

portal login ticket: eyJhbGciOiJIUzI1NiIsInR5cCI6IkpXVCJ9.eyJzdWIiOiIwEOsktwVNwIn0.-UJU3fdyyCgG